chore: more ruff rules and overall minor improvements (#7386)

* overall prettyfication

- don't create empty mutable containers (lists, dicts) where it is appropriate
- removed from ignore section and applied some rules from ruff (but keep them ignored in tests)
- use `deque` in `_AsyncCooperatorAdapter` instead of `list.pop(0)`
- remove `f` prefix from strings without any formatting

* return `SIM300` to ignore

* apply ruff rules to all files

* another one

* remove extra space in pyproject.toml

* simplify `__getattr__` in `scrapy.utils.url`

* lazy `url_is_from_any_domain` and `url_is_from_spider`

* improve typing

* specify `arg_to_iter` with None as arg
